I'm download with 56K modem for about 5Hrs now, I'm getting between 4.7 and 5.3 kbs. The whole download with a 56K modem should take about 24 - 28 hrs.

Make sure your don't have other auto-update programs like windows update, virus protection, popup blockers, music programs, MS/AOL messenger, etc) or schedled tasks running. Limit the number of programs running in your system tray.

Surfing the web while downloading doesn't help either[;)]!
